AUDIO Menu

• Audio Mode: Lets you choose the default audio mode for conventional analog programs. When you view
a program broadcast in mono, you will hear only mono sound, even though Stereo mode is set. When
Second Audio Program(SAP) mode is set, the program's second audio program, usually the program's dia-
log in another language, is broadcast in mono, if provided.
• EZ Sound Rite: Scans for changes in sound level during commercials, then adjusts the sound to match
the current audio level. This will make sure that the volume level will be consistent whether you are
watching a commercial or a regular TV program.
• EZ Audio: Allows you to choose an appropriate listening setting based on different audio option. They
are: Off, News, Movie, Music and EZ Surround. Off resets all audio settings to the original levels.
• Balance: Lets you adjust the left to right balance of the internal speakers.
• Treble: Increases or decreases the higher frequency sounds of the internal speakers. Increases in treble,
for example, make voice or string sounds stand out.
• Bass: Increases or decreases the lower frequency sounds of the internal speakers. Increases in bass, for
example, make percussion stand out.
• Internal Speaker: Allows you to toggle the internal speakers on or off. If you want to use your external hi-
fi stereo system, turn off the internal speakers. However, you may use the internal speakers as a center
speaker to create a surround effect.
